Notes on YCombinator's How to Launch video

- Do not overthink the launch
- No one will care when you launch
- Always be shipping
- Launch ASAP — helps determine if you are solving real problem a.k.a problem someone is willing to pay for solving
- Launch unpolished
- If you launch and no one cares, launch again. AirBnB launched 3 times.
- Launch and iterate, see the response on messaging quicker.
- Launch on different channels
- “No one cares” is not a reason to give up (no potato growing for me)
- Do not lie to yourself
- Make 100 users happy
- Making a few users happy is a great boost for your moral
- Expanding user base will take time
- Create [[Textjoint — one sentence pitch|one sentence pitch]]
- Clear idea is the best foundation for growth
- Clear idea helps grow organically.
- It takes time to get good at taking about your idea
- Do silent launch: website with name, description, CTA and contact info
- Share with friend and family
- Launch to strangers
- Start talking to potential customers
- Launch for online communities.
- Be authentic, no promo language
- Build community, duh
